From New Guinea to Hawaii, and from Rapa Nui to New Zealand, Oceania is a network of islands and cultures united by the Pacific. This has not only been their livelihood, but has also inspired the development of their creativity.
The exhibition features more than two hundred historical and contemporary pieces from the British Museum's collections dedicated to Pacific Island peoples. These include ceremonial paddles, basalt ancestor figures, mulberry bark garments, hats, models of war canoes, necklaces and nose ornaments, and mother-of-pearl fishhooks. A comprehensive showcase of the artistic genius of Oceanic peoples is structured into seven areas: innovation and tradition, innovators, weavers, dancers, warriors, carvers, and travelers.
